織夢(mèng)模板是一款廣泛應(yīng)用于企業(yè)網(wǎng)站建設(shè)的開源CMS系統(tǒng),具有操作簡(jiǎn)單、擴(kuò)展容易和協(xié)同性強(qiáng)等優(yōu)點(diǎn)。在使用織夢(mèng)模板建站過程中,CSS樣式表的調(diào)用是不可少的一步。本文將從如何引入CSS樣式表、CSS的樣式定義、CSS的樣式繼承等三個(gè)方面進(jìn)行詳細(xì)介紹。
1. 引入CSS樣式表
引入CSS樣式表是通過在head元素中插入link元素來實(shí)現(xiàn)的。link元素用于定義文檔與外部資源之間的關(guān)系,屬性rel用于指定關(guān)系類型,type用于指定資源類型,href用于指定資源位置。代碼如下:
<head> <link rel="stylesheet" type="text/css" href="style.css"> </head>style.css是在網(wǎng)站根目錄下創(chuàng)建的CSS文件,文件名可以根據(jù)需要自行規(guī)定。 2. CSS的樣式定義 CSS樣式定義由選擇器和聲明塊兩部分組成。選擇器用于指定想要改變樣式的HTML元素,聲明塊用于指定要改變的樣式屬性及其值。例如,我們希望修改所有段落的文字顏色為紅色,可以使用以下代碼:
p{ color: red; }其中p為選擇器,color為屬性名,red為屬性值。在聲明塊中可以同時(shí)定義多個(gè)屬性,多個(gè)屬性間用分號(hào)隔開。 3. CSS的樣式繼承 CSS的樣式繼承是指子元素會(huì)自動(dòng)繼承父元素的某些樣式屬性。例如,我們?yōu)閎ody元素定義一個(gè)背景色,該背景色的屬性值將不僅被應(yīng)用于body元素本身,還會(huì)應(yīng)用于body元素的所有子元素。我們也可以為一個(gè)元素定義一個(gè)字體樣式,該字體樣式會(huì)應(yīng)用于該元素的所有后代元素。例如:
body{ background-color: #eee; font-family: Arial; }如果我們?cè)俣x以下樣式:
h1{ font-size: 36px; }雖然沒有為h1元素指定字體樣式,但是h1元素繼承了其父元素body的字體樣式,也就是使用了Arial字體。而如果我們?yōu)閔1元素同時(shí)指定字體樣式,該元素會(huì)覆蓋繼承的字體樣式,以其自己的字體樣式為準(zhǔn)。 通過對(duì)織夢(mèng)模板CSS的調(diào)用的介紹,我們可以更好地理解CSS在網(wǎng)頁開發(fā)過程中的作用,掌握基本的CSS編寫方法,并能夠更加自如地應(yīng)用于網(wǎng)站建設(shè)。